๐๏ธ 1. Amazon Echo Pop โ Best Budget Smart Speaker
Price Range: ~$40
Why Itโs Great:
- Compact Alexa speaker
- Controls smart devices, sets routines, and answers questions
- Cute, colorful design fits in small spaces
Ideal For: First-time smart home users, bedrooms, or small apartments.
๐ 2. TP-Link Kasa Smart Plug Mini โ Easiest Automation Tool
Price Range: ~$15โ20 (often in 2-packs)
Why Itโs Great:
- Turn any plug-in device into a smart appliance
- Works with Alexa, Google Assistant
- Set timers and schedules in the app
Ideal For: Lamps, coffee makers, fans, or holiday lights.
๐ก 3. Wyze Bulb Color โ Best Budget Smart Light Bulb
Price Range: ~$13โ15
Why Itโs Great:
- Millions of colors + tunable white
- Voice and app control
- Schedules, automation, and grouping options
Ideal For: Mood lighting, wake-up routines, or colorful ambience.
๐น 4. Blink Mini 2 โ Affordable Indoor Security Camera
Price Range: ~$30
Why Itโs Great:
- 1080p HD with two-way audio
- Person detection (with subscription)
- Works with Alexa for voice viewing
Ideal For: Monitoring pets, kids, or entryways without extra wiring.
๐ง 5. Govee Smart Thermo-Hygrometer โ Best Budget Climate Monitor
Price Range: ~$15โ20
Why Itโs Great:
- Tracks temperature and humidity in real-time
- Pairs with app for alerts and history
- Compact design for any room
Ideal For: Nurseries, wine storage, or plant care.
๐๏ธ 6. Meross Smart Garage Door Opener โ Best Value for Security
Price Range: ~$45
Why Itโs Great:
- Open/close your garage via app or voice
- Compatible with Alexa, Google, and SmartThings
- Easy to install and monitor remotely
Ideal For: Homeowners who want affordable smart security upgrades.
๐ 7. SwitchBot Bot โ Smart Switch for Dumb Devices
Price Range: ~$30
Why Itโs Great:
- Mechanically flips switches or buttons
- Works on coffee makers, light switches, or even PCs
- Voice and app control with hub
Ideal For: Retrofits on appliances you can’t smarten the traditional way.
๐ง What to Look for in Budget Smart Devices
โ Compatibility
Stick to devices that work with your current ecosystem (Alexa, Google Home, SmartThings).
๐ถ Connectivity
Look for Wi-Fi or Bluetooth options that donโt require expensive hubs.
๐ Energy Efficiency
Smart plugs and bulbs can cut energy useโlook for energy-monitoring features.
๐ฆ Expandability
Choose brands with multiple products so you can build your smart home over time.
